Possible models for the earliest prebreakdown events in DC stressed hexane
Observed phenomena in liquid hexane at a point cathode include the formation of a low-density region (LDR), a chain of growing electrical pulses, a succession of light flashes, and a final disruption and termination of the process. The authors address three separate effects: the inception of the process; the growth of the low-density region, with electrical pulses and light emission; and the break-up of the low-density region. It is shown that it is possible to predict the onset, growth, pulse and light phenomena, termination of growth, and break-up of the low-density region in terms of electrical and fluid dynamical processes.<>
